Up to 4 different transmitters may be programmed into the RS units's memory. When
a new transmitter code is programmed, all previous codes will be deleted. If a third
or fourth transmitter is desired, all of the transmitters must be programmed.

1)

 Turn ignition "On".

2)

 Press & Release Program button 5 times.

- The parking lights will flash 5 times to confirm entry into programing mode.

3)

 Press any button of new Transmitter to be programed.

- The parking lights will flash to confirm that the Transmitter has been learned.

4

) To program additional transmitters, Repeat step 

#

3.

5)

 Turn ignition "Off".

Note 1: It is recommended that all four transmitter memory slots be filled. For
example: If you have two transmitters, program each one twice.

Note 2: The RS unit will automatically exit programing mode if 10 seconds elapse
without receiving a signal from the transmitter(s).
